I redid my process programming last night. I'm currently set up using three processes.
Process0: Mash Process - Heating Water>Hold Strike Temp>Mash In>Sac Rest>Mashout>Hold Mashout>Ready for Sparge
Process1: Sparging Process - Lautering>Sparge w/Preheat>Ready for Boil
Process2: Boil Wort

Most of my transitions are controlled by temp targets, timers, float switches, or manual button. I'm trying to use state programming as much as possible with ladder logic running in the background with desired rungs being controlled by active registers asserted in a state. Everything is working like I want it, but the true test will be when I finish (I mean start) wiring my control panel.
